We are seeking a dedicated and inspiring Year 6 Teacherto join our welcoming and inclusive primary school in Hounslow. This is a full-time permanent position starting in January 2026 offering an excellent opportunity to play a key role in supporting pupils through their final year of primary education and preparing them for secondary school. This role will involve teaching a diverse Year 6 class with varying learning needs including pupils with Special Educational Needs (SEN). We are looking for a teacher who is reflective adaptable and committed to fostering an inclusive and engaging classroom where every child can achieve their potential.
Start Date: January 2026
Contract Type: Permanent
Working Pattern: Full Time Term Time Only
Salary: MPS/UPS (Dependent on Experience)
Suitable for: Experienced or Early Career Teachers (ECTs welcome)
Key Responsibilities
- Plan and deliver stimulating differentiated lessons that prepare pupils for end-of-Key Stage 2 assessments and beyond.
- Support pupils with a range of SEN and additional learning needs ensuring lessons are accessible inclusive and engaging.
- Assess track and celebrate pupil progress using data to inform teaching and interventions.
- Foster a positive resilient classroom culture that promotes curiosity confidence and a love of learning.
- Work collaboratively with support staff the SENCo and parents to provide holistic support for every child.
- Contribute to wider school initiatives enrichment activities and whole-school development.
